织梦如何在数据库重命名文章aid:重命名文章aid、使用数据库操作、注意数据完整性、备份数据库。 在织梦内容管理系统(DEDECMS)中,重命名文章aid的过程涉及对数据库的直接操作。需要注意的是,进行此类操作之前务必备份数据库,确保数据的安全和完整性。以下详细介绍如何通过数据库重命名文章aid。
一、织梦系统与数据库结构概述
织梦(DEDECMS)是国内广泛使用的内容管理系统,它的数据存储主要依赖于MySQL数据库。了解织梦的数据库结构是进行任何数据库操作的前提。
1、主要数据库表
在织梦系统中,与文章相关的主要数据库表包括:
dede_archives
:主要存储文章的基本信息。dede_addonarticle
:存储文章的详细内容。dede_arctiny
:存储简要的文章信息,常用于快速索引。
2、aid的定义与作用
aid
(Article ID)是文章的唯一标识符,用于在各个表之间关联文章数据。修改aid
需要确保各表中的数据一致性。
二、重命名文章aid的准备工作
1、备份数据库
在进行任何数据库操作之前,备份数据库是必不可少的步骤。可以通过phpMyAdmin、Navicat等工具导出数据库备份。
2、分析数据关联性
确保对涉及aid
的所有表和字段进行全面分析,避免遗漏,导致数据不一致。
三、具体操作步骤
1、查找并更新dede_archives
表
首先,我们需要在dede_archives
表中找到并更新目标文章的aid
。
UPDATE `dede_archives` SET `id` = 新的aid WHERE `id` = 原来的aid;
2、查找并更新dede_addonarticle
表
接下来,需要在dede_addonarticle
表中更新对应文章的aid
。
UPDATE `dede_addonarticle` SET `aid` = 新的aid WHERE `aid` = 原来的aid;
3、查找并更新dede_arctiny
表
最后,在dede_arctiny
表中更新文章的aid
。
UPDATE `dede_arctiny` SET `id` = 新的aid WHERE `id` = 原来的aid;
四、验证数据完整性
1、检查数据一致性
完成上述步骤后,检查各个表中的数据是否一致,确保没有遗漏或错误。
2、测试网站功能
通过前台和后台对网站进行全面测试,确保修改后的aid
正常工作,网站功能不受影响。
五、注意事项
1、定期备份
即使在平时的维护中,也应定期备份数据库,防止数据丢失。
2、避免频繁修改
频繁修改aid
可能导致数据混乱,建议仅在必要时进行修改。
3、使用专业工具
推荐使用专业的项目管理系统,如研发项目管理系统PingCode和通用项目协作软件Worktile,以便更高效地管理项目,提高工作效率。
4、寻求专业帮助
如果对数据库操作不熟悉,建议寻求专业技术人员的帮助,以避免不必要的风险。
六、总结
通过上述步骤,我们可以在织梦系统中安全地重命名文章aid。重命名文章aid、使用数据库操作、注意数据完整性、备份数据库是整个过程的核心要素。在操作过程中,务必谨慎,确保数据的安全和完整。
相关问答FAQs:
Q: 如何在织梦中将数据库中的文章aid重命名?
A: 重命名织梦数据库中的文章aid需要按照以下步骤进行操作:
-
如何找到数据库中的文章aid?
在织梦后台中,进入“数据库管理”,找到对应的文章数据库表,通常是以“dede_archives”命名的表。在该表中,找到“aid”字段,这是文章的唯一标识。 -
如何重命名数据库中的文章aid?
首先,备份你的数据库以防止意外情况发生。然后,使用数据库管理工具(如phpMyAdmin)登录到你的数据库。找到文章aid所在的数据库表,点击“编辑”或“修改”按钮。在“aid”字段中输入新的文章aid,然后保存更改。 -
重命名后是否会影响其他相关数据?
是的,重命名文章aid可能会影响与之相关的数据。例如,如果其他数据库表中有与文章aid关联的数据(如评论、标签等),你需要相应地更新这些数据中的aid,以确保数据的一致性。 -
重命名文章aid后是否会影响前台展示?
是的,重命名文章aid后,前台展示可能会受到影响。因为文章的URL通常是基于aid生成的,所以需要相应地更新文章的URL。你可以通过织梦后台的“更新栏目缓存”和“更新文档缓存”功能来更新文章URL。
请注意,重命名数据库中的文章aid是一项敏感的操作,建议在操作前备份数据库,并确保你对数据库操作有一定的了解。如有需要,可以咨询专业的织梦开发者或技术支持人员。
原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1986952